Below is my final energy expenditure to West 125th Street. It's a program to enlist local artists to interpret the cultural landscape history of the site and with the help of an architecture/planning studio, turn the interpretations into a type of site installation during construction. This is something the community requested each time we met with them, and now that I have access to academia and an acute knowledge of the site and players involved, can possibly make it happen, or at the very least, instigate a conversation amongst the powers that be. I hope. We shall see, as emails are sent off to create possibility.
